Java语言里,一般使用JDBC来连接各种数据库,若连接到Oracle数据库,则需要使用Oracle的JDBC驱动程序。该驱动程序,可在Oracle官方网站上下载,或者可由Oracle数据库的安装目录里获取,对于使用JDK8的用户来说,仅需要一个ojdbc6.jar文件即可实现与Oracle数据库的连接。 Windows操作系统下,该文件在安装目录的jdbc/lib目录下。Linux操作系统下,
转载 2023-11-09 00:07:45
119阅读
## 如何实现Java调用sqlplus执行SQL ### 1. 流程图 ```mermaid flowchart TD A(开始) --> B(编写Java代码) B --> C(调用sqlplus执行SQL) C --> D(结束) ``` ### 2. 步骤 | 步骤 | 操作 | | ------ | ------ | | 1 | 编写Java代码 | |
原创 2024-02-25 05:49:39
107阅读
在Linux操作系统中,使用红帽(Red Hat)发行版的用户可能会遇到需要调用SQLPlus的情况。SQLPlus是Oracle数据库管理系统中的一个命令行工具,用于执行SQL语句和PL/SQL块。在Linux系统中,要使用SQLPlus首先需要安装Oracle客户端,并设置环境变量。接下来我们将介绍在红帽Linux中如何调用SQLPlus。 首先,确保已经安装了Oracle客户端。可以访问O
原创 2024-05-06 11:39:13
107阅读
我上一篇文章写了集成,这里说下使用。先看下官方提供了很多方法:这里通过的CRUD满足不了时,条件构造器就派上用场了。主要提供了实体包装器,用于处理 sql 拼接,排序,实体参数查询等!这里需要注意:使用的是数据库字段,不是Java属性!,原来使用另一款通用mapper时记得使用的是JAVA属性。Sql拼接条件:@RunWith(SpringRunner.class) //SpringBootTes
转载 2023-10-19 07:42:48
54阅读
## Python调用SQLPlus执行SQL 在数据分析和数据处理的过程中,我们经常需要使用SQL语言来查询和处理数据。而对于大部分人来说,SQLPlus是一个非常常用的工具,它可以用来与Oracle数据库进行交互,并执行SQL语句。那么,如何在Python中调用SQLPlus来执行SQL语句呢? 本文将介绍如何使用Python调用SQLPlus执行SQL语句,并提供相应的代码示例。 ##
原创 2023-11-26 10:26:57
262阅读
Java,PL/SQL调用 ORACLE存储函数以及存储过程ONE Goal , ONE Passion !准备工作创建表--- 创建测试用表 school CREATE TABLE school( ID number, --学校id NAME VARCHAR2(30) ---学校名 );
转载 2023-10-27 01:44:32
96阅读
# JavaSQLPlus的介绍与比较 ## 引言 Java是一种广泛使用的编程语言,而SQLPlus是Oracle数据库管理系统中的一个交互式命令行工具。本文将介绍JavaSQLPlus的基本概念、特点以及它们在数据库编程中的应用。我们还将以代码示例的形式展示JavaSQLPlus的使用方法和效果,以帮助读者更好地理解它们之间的关系和区别。 ## Java概述 Java是一种面向对
原创 2023-07-21 19:11:55
103阅读
1、执行带有输出类型参数的存储过程set serveroutput on; DECLARE dwbh varchar2(20); out_param varchar2(1000); BEGIN dwbh:='3609000001'; pkg_znpj.znpj_zf(dwbh,out_param); dbms_output.put_line(ou
转载 2023-05-26 10:02:41
228阅读
一、创建存储过程1、oracle创建存储过程的语法oracle存储过程 语法格式 CREATE OR REPLACE PROCEDURE procedureName IS DECLARE ....... BEGIN ........... END;2、oracle创建存储过程的样例连接到: Oracle Database 11g Enterprise Edition Release 1
在这篇博文中,我将介绍如何在 Java 中使用 SQL*Plus。SQL*Plus 是 Oracle 数据库的命令行工具,如何将其有效地与 Java 代码结合使用,是很多开发者面临的挑战。本文将包括多个部分:版本对比、迁移指南、兼容性处理、实战案例、性能优化,以及生态扩展,希望能帮助大家更好地理解这一过程。 ## 版本对比 在理解 Java 与 SQL*Plus 结合的过程中,我们首先需要对不
原创 6月前
31阅读
## 实现Java执行sqlplus的流程 ### 1. 流程图 ```mermaid flowchart TD A(开始) --> B(创建Java程序) B --> C(导入必要的类库) C --> D(连接数据库) D --> E(执行SQL命令) E --> F(关闭数据库连接) F --> G(结束) ``` ### 2. 步骤及代码
原创 2023-11-30 08:11:39
73阅读
​2014-06-20  Created By BaoXinjian​​一、摘要​如果在Oracle EBS中开发Unix Shell,必定会涉及到在Shell中调用PLSQL,在Shell调用PLSQL一般是通过SQLPlus这个工具关于SQLPlus需明白SQLPlus的登录方式和常用命令,具体的在另文介绍SQLPlus的用法1. SQLPlus的登录方式sqlplus [ [<opti
原创 2022-03-09 14:16:58
1528阅读
在我发一个新的版本给客户,这个时
转载 2016-11-24 22:45:00
68阅读
2评论
在windows上使用sqlplus,可以用上下键头调用历史执行过的命令,而且可以移动光标方便的修改命令,在linux可就不那么方便了,那么在linux也可以实现历史命令回调吗?答案是肯定的,步骤如下:  在linux中实现上述功能,需要一个小工具,叫做rlwrap,这个程式本身是个Shell,可以运行任何你提供给它的命令包括参数,并添加命令历史浏览功能。 The
转载 精选 2012-03-31 23:58:15
645阅读
# Java使用SQLPlus ## 1. 介绍 SQLPlus是Oracle数据库系统中的一种标准交互式工具,它可以被用来运行SQL和PL/SQL语句,以及执行存储在文件中的SQL语句。在Java程序中,我们可以通过调用SQLPlus来执行SQL语句,从而与Oracle数据库进行交互。 ## 2. Java调用SQLPlus示例 下面是一个简单的Java程序示例,演示如何通过Java调用S
原创 2024-06-13 04:03:33
92阅读
在用golang开发人工客服系统的时候碰到了粘包问题,那么什么是粘包呢?例如我们和客户端约定数据交互格式是一个json格式的字符串:{"Id":1,"Name":"golang","Message":"message"}当客户端发送数据给服务端的时候,如果服务端没有及时接收,客户端又发送了一条数据上来,这时候服务端才进行接收的话就会收到两个连续的字符串,形如:{"Id":1,"Name":"gol
转载 10月前
28阅读
使用Oracle 11g 64位服务器,安装64位、32位客户端,出现SQLPlus无法连接数据库,PLSql可以连接问题。网上查了很多,都不能解决问题,在下面提供一种。环境变量右击计算机属性-->高级系统设置-->高级-->环境变量-->系统变量-->Path将 E:\app\Administrator\product\11.2.0\dbhome_1\bin 放到E
转载 2023-07-05 23:27:33
91阅读
• 介绍 sqlplus dev/dev@192.168.133.146:1521/orclimp system/suren@orcl file=20161018.dmp full=y 异常ORA-12504: TNS: 监听程序在 CONNECT_DATA 中未获得 SERVICE_NAME可能是对应的Windows服务(OracleOraDB12Home1TNSListener或者Oracle
原创 2022-10-17 08:40:45
58阅读
conn user/pwd@192.168.0.188:1521/orcl as sysdba;
原创 2021-12-23 14:22:27
158阅读
目录SPI定义SPI核心方法和类最简单的SPIdemo演示回顾JCBC基本流程为什么JDBC要有SPIJDBC java.sql.Driver后门利用与验证SPI定义SPI: Service Provider Interface 官方定义: 直译过来是服务提供者接口,学名为服务发现机制 它通过在ClassPath路径下的META-INF/services文件夹中查找文件(以接口名为文件名,以实现类
转载 10月前
30阅读
  • 1
  • 2
  • 3
  • 4
  • 5